This is an automated email from the ASF dual-hosted git repository.

twalthr pushed a change to branch FLINK-39256
in repository https://gitbox.apache.org/repos/asf/flink.git


 discard ddb93ca3e85 Remove single partition ORDER BY
 discard e38f5fc0baf Fix spotless
 discard 67c8ae16744 Feedback addressed
 discard bb83b36917f [FLINK-39256][table] Support ORDER BY clause in Process 
Table Functions
     add d8010df8795 [FLINK-39394][web] Fix job overview metrics broken when a 
vertex is finished
     add e4280d4f168 [FLINK-38893][runtime/rest] Introduce the 
/jobs/:jobid/rescales/overview endpoint in the REST API
     add 5ba9166f729 [FLINK-38898][runtime-web] Introduce the Rescales/Overview 
sub-page for streaming jobs with the adaptive scheduler enabled
     add 096f031b950 [FLINK-38898][runtime-web] Refactor Rescale Details 
related parts into templates for reusing in Rescales/Overview and 
Rescales/History
     add 983e76fa087 Update version to 2.4-SNAPSHOT
     add 27688329838 [FLINK-39446] Add version 2.4 and update nightly build 
action
     add 27328b89f8a [FLINK-39443][release] Build docs for release-2.3 branch
     add 496f8a87ed1 [FLINK-39457][docs/tests] Upgrade version tag from 
'2.3-SNAPSHOT' to '2.4-SNAPSHOT' in REST-API related doc files to fix CI 
failure (#27938)
     add d5cfc67d0dc [FLINK-39256][table] Support ORDER BY clause in Process 
Table Functions
     add b4fee373bdc Feedback addressed
     add 8b590186a93 Fix spotless
     add 7be1f01a119 Remove single partition ORDER BY
     add 69959fdb802 Fix arch checks

This update added new revisions after undoing existing revisions.
That is to say, some revisions that were in the old version of the
branch are not in the new version.  This situation occurs
when a user --force pushes a change and generates a repository
containing something like this:

 * -- * -- B -- O -- O -- O   (ddb93ca3e85)
            \
             N -- N -- N   refs/heads/FLINK-39256 (69959fdb802)

You should already have received notification emails for all of the O
revisions, and so the following emails describe only the N revisions
from the common base, B.

Any revisions marked "omit" are not gone; other references still
refer to them.  Any revisions marked "discard" are gone forever.

No new revisions were added by this update.

Summary of changes:
 .github/workflows/docs.yml                         |   1 +
 .github/workflows/nightly-trigger.yml              |   2 +-
 docs/config.toml                                   |   4 +-
 .../shortcodes/generated/rest_v1_dispatcher.html   | 227 ++++++++
 docs/static/generated/rest_v1_dispatcher.yml       |  51 +-
 docs/static/generated/rest_v1_sql_gateway.yml      |   2 +-
 docs/static/generated/rest_v2_sql_gateway.yml      |   2 +-
 docs/static/generated/rest_v3_sql_gateway.yml      |   2 +-
 docs/static/generated/rest_v4_sql_gateway.yml      |   2 +-
 flink-annotations/pom.xml                          |   2 +-
 .../main/java/org/apache/flink/FlinkVersion.java   |   3 +-
 .../flink-architecture-tests-base/pom.xml          |   2 +-
 .../flink-architecture-tests-production/pom.xml    |   2 +-
 .../flink-architecture-tests-test/pom.xml          |   2 +-
 flink-architecture-tests/pom.xml                   |   2 +-
 flink-clients/pom.xml                              |   2 +-
 flink-connectors/flink-connector-base/pom.xml      |   2 +-
 .../flink-connector-datagen-test/pom.xml           |   2 +-
 flink-connectors/flink-connector-datagen/pom.xml   |   2 +-
 flink-connectors/flink-connector-files/pom.xml     |   2 +-
 flink-connectors/flink-file-sink-common/pom.xml    |   2 +-
 .../flink-hadoop-compatibility/pom.xml             |   2 +-
 flink-connectors/pom.xml                           |   2 +-
 flink-container/pom.xml                            |   2 +-
 flink-core-api/pom.xml                             |   2 +-
 flink-core/pom.xml                                 |   2 +-
 flink-datastream-api/pom.xml                       |   2 +-
 flink-datastream/pom.xml                           |   2 +-
 flink-dist-scala/pom.xml                           |   2 +-
 flink-dist/pom.xml                                 |   2 +-
 flink-docs/pom.xml                                 |   2 +-
 flink-dstl/flink-dstl-dfs/pom.xml                  |   2 +-
 flink-dstl/pom.xml                                 |   2 +-
 .../flink-batch-sql-test/pom.xml                   |   2 +-
 flink-end-to-end-tests/flink-cli-test/pom.xml      |   2 +-
 .../flink-confluent-schema-registry/pom.xml        |   2 +-
 .../flink-datastream-allround-test/pom.xml         |   2 +-
 .../flink-distributed-cache-via-blob-test/pom.xml  |   4 +-
 .../flink-end-to-end-tests-common/pom.xml          |   2 +-
 .../flink-end-to-end-tests-jdbc-driver/pom.xml     |   2 +-
 .../flink-end-to-end-tests-restclient/pom.xml      |   2 +-
 .../flink-end-to-end-tests-scala/pom.xml           |   2 +-
 .../flink-end-to-end-tests-sql/pom.xml             |   2 +-
 .../flink-end-to-end-tests-table-api/pom.xml       |   2 +-
 .../flink-failure-enricher-test/pom.xml            |   2 +-
 .../flink-file-sink-test/pom.xml                   |   2 +-
 .../flink-heavy-deployment-stress-test/pom.xml     |   2 +-
 .../pom.xml                                        |   2 +-
 .../flink-metrics-availability-test/pom.xml        |   2 +-
 .../flink-metrics-reporter-prometheus-test/pom.xml |   2 +-
 .../pom.xml                                        |   2 +-
 .../pom.xml                                        |   2 +-
 .../pom.xml                                        |   2 +-
 .../flink-plugins-test/another-dummy-fs/pom.xml    |   2 +-
 .../flink-plugins-test/dummy-fs/pom.xml            |   2 +-
 flink-end-to-end-tests/flink-plugins-test/pom.xml  |   2 +-
 flink-end-to-end-tests/flink-python-test/pom.xml   |   2 +-
 .../flink-queryable-state-test/pom.xml             |   2 +-
 .../flink-quickstart-test-dummy-dependency/pom.xml |   2 +-
 .../flink-quickstart-test/pom.xml                  |   2 +-
 .../pom.xml                                        |   2 +-
 .../flink-sql-client-test/pom.xml                  |   2 +-
 .../flink-state-evolution-test/pom.xml             |   2 +-
 .../flink-stream-sql-test/pom.xml                  |   2 +-
 .../flink-stream-state-ttl-test/pom.xml            |   2 +-
 .../flink-stream-stateful-job-upgrade-test/pom.xml |   2 +-
 flink-end-to-end-tests/flink-tpcds-test/pom.xml    |   2 +-
 flink-end-to-end-tests/flink-tpch-test/pom.xml     |   2 +-
 flink-end-to-end-tests/pom.xml                     |   2 +-
 .../flink-examples-streaming-state-machine/pom.xml |   2 +-
 flink-examples/flink-examples-build-helper/pom.xml |   2 +-
 flink-examples/flink-examples-streaming/pom.xml    |   2 +-
 flink-examples/flink-examples-table/pom.xml        |   2 +-
 flink-examples/pom.xml                             |   2 +-
 .../flink-external-resource-gpu/pom.xml            |   2 +-
 flink-external-resources/pom.xml                   |   2 +-
 flink-filesystems/flink-azure-fs-hadoop/pom.xml    |   2 +-
 flink-filesystems/flink-fs-hadoop-shaded/pom.xml   |   2 +-
 flink-filesystems/flink-gs-fs-hadoop/pom.xml       |   2 +-
 flink-filesystems/flink-hadoop-fs/pom.xml          |   2 +-
 flink-filesystems/flink-oss-fs-hadoop/pom.xml      |   2 +-
 flink-filesystems/flink-s3-fs-base/pom.xml         |   2 +-
 flink-filesystems/flink-s3-fs-hadoop/pom.xml       |   2 +-
 flink-filesystems/flink-s3-fs-native/pom.xml       |   2 +-
 flink-filesystems/flink-s3-fs-presto/pom.xml       |   2 +-
 flink-filesystems/pom.xml                          |   2 +-
 .../flink-avro-confluent-registry/pom.xml          |   2 +-
 flink-formats/flink-avro/pom.xml                   |   2 +-
 flink-formats/flink-compress/pom.xml               |   2 +-
 flink-formats/flink-csv/pom.xml                    |   2 +-
 flink-formats/flink-format-common/pom.xml          |   2 +-
 flink-formats/flink-hadoop-bulk/pom.xml            |   2 +-
 flink-formats/flink-json/pom.xml                   |   2 +-
 flink-formats/flink-orc-nohive/pom.xml             |   2 +-
 flink-formats/flink-orc/pom.xml                    |   2 +-
 flink-formats/flink-parquet/pom.xml                |   2 +-
 flink-formats/flink-protobuf/pom.xml               |   2 +-
 flink-formats/flink-sequence-file/pom.xml          |   2 +-
 .../flink-sql-avro-confluent-registry/pom.xml      |   2 +-
 flink-formats/flink-sql-avro/pom.xml               |   2 +-
 flink-formats/flink-sql-csv/pom.xml                |   2 +-
 flink-formats/flink-sql-json/pom.xml               |   2 +-
 flink-formats/flink-sql-orc/pom.xml                |   2 +-
 flink-formats/flink-sql-parquet/pom.xml            |   2 +-
 flink-formats/flink-sql-protobuf/pom.xml           |   2 +-
 flink-formats/pom.xml                              |   2 +-
 flink-fs-tests/pom.xml                             |   2 +-
 flink-kubernetes/pom.xml                           |   2 +-
 flink-libraries/flink-cep/pom.xml                  |   2 +-
 flink-libraries/flink-state-processing-api/pom.xml |   2 +-
 flink-libraries/pom.xml                            |   2 +-
 flink-metrics/flink-metrics-core/pom.xml           |   2 +-
 flink-metrics/flink-metrics-datadog/pom.xml        |   2 +-
 flink-metrics/flink-metrics-dropwizard/pom.xml     |   2 +-
 flink-metrics/flink-metrics-graphite/pom.xml       |   2 +-
 flink-metrics/flink-metrics-influxdb/pom.xml       |   2 +-
 flink-metrics/flink-metrics-jmx/pom.xml            |   2 +-
 flink-metrics/flink-metrics-otel/pom.xml           |   2 +-
 flink-metrics/flink-metrics-prometheus/pom.xml     |   2 +-
 flink-metrics/flink-metrics-slf4j/pom.xml          |   2 +-
 flink-metrics/flink-metrics-statsd/pom.xml         |   2 +-
 flink-metrics/pom.xml                              |   2 +-
 flink-models/flink-model-openai/pom.xml            |   2 +-
 flink-models/flink-model-triton/pom.xml            |   2 +-
 flink-models/pom.xml                               |   2 +-
 flink-python/pom.xml                               |   2 +-
 flink-python/pyflink/version.py                    |   2 +-
 .../flink-queryable-state-client-java/pom.xml      |   2 +-
 .../flink-queryable-state-runtime/pom.xml          |   2 +-
 flink-queryable-state/pom.xml                      |   2 +-
 flink-quickstart/flink-quickstart-java/pom.xml     |   2 +-
 flink-quickstart/pom.xml                           |   2 +-
 flink-rpc/flink-rpc-akka-loader/pom.xml            |   2 +-
 flink-rpc/flink-rpc-akka/pom.xml                   |   2 +-
 flink-rpc/flink-rpc-core/pom.xml                   |   2 +-
 flink-rpc/pom.xml                                  |   2 +-
 flink-runtime-web/pom.xml                          |   2 +-
 .../src/test/resources/rest_api_v1.snapshot        | 203 +++++++
 .../src/app/interfaces/job-rescales.ts             |  18 +
 .../pages/job/overview/job-overview.component.ts   |  16 +-
 .../pages/job/rescales/job-rescales.component.html | 583 ++++++++++++---------
 .../pages/job/rescales/job-rescales.component.less |  52 +-
 .../pages/job/rescales/job-rescales.component.ts   |  49 +-
 .../web-dashboard/src/app/services/job.service.ts  |   5 +
 flink-runtime/pom.xml                              |   2 +-
 ...andler.java => JobRescalesOverviewHandler.java} |  35 +-
 .../messages/job/rescales/JobRescalesOverview.java | 246 +++++++++
 ...eaders.java => JobRescalesOverviewHeaders.java} |  24 +-
 .../runtime/webmonitor/WebMonitorEndpoint.java     |  15 +
 ...st.java => JobRescalesOverviewHandlerTest.java} | 128 ++---
 .../flink-statebackend-changelog/pom.xml           |   2 +-
 .../flink-statebackend-common/pom.xml              |   2 +-
 .../flink-statebackend-forst/pom.xml               |   2 +-
 .../flink-statebackend-heap-spillable/pom.xml      |   2 +-
 .../flink-statebackend-rocksdb/pom.xml             |   2 +-
 flink-state-backends/pom.xml                       |   2 +-
 flink-streaming-java/pom.xml                       |   2 +-
 flink-table/flink-sql-client/pom.xml               |   2 +-
 flink-table/flink-sql-gateway-api/pom.xml          |   2 +-
 flink-table/flink-sql-gateway/pom.xml              |   2 +-
 flink-table/flink-sql-jdbc-driver-bundle/pom.xml   |   2 +-
 flink-table/flink-sql-jdbc-driver/pom.xml          |   2 +-
 flink-table/flink-sql-parser/pom.xml               |   2 +-
 flink-table/flink-table-api-bridge-base/pom.xml    |   2 +-
 flink-table/flink-table-api-java-bridge/pom.xml    |   2 +-
 flink-table/flink-table-api-java-uber/pom.xml      |   2 +-
 flink-table/flink-table-api-java/pom.xml           |   2 +-
 flink-table/flink-table-api-scala-bridge/pom.xml   |   2 +-
 flink-table/flink-table-api-scala/pom.xml          |   2 +-
 flink-table/flink-table-calcite-bridge/pom.xml     |   2 +-
 flink-table/flink-table-code-splitter/pom.xml      |   2 +-
 flink-table/flink-table-common/pom.xml             |   2 +-
 .../flink/table/functions/TableSemantics.java      |   3 +-
 .../flink-table-planner-loader-bundle/pom.xml      |   2 +-
 flink-table/flink-table-planner-loader/pom.xml     |   2 +-
 flink-table/flink-table-planner/pom.xml            |   2 +-
 flink-table/flink-table-runtime/pom.xml            |   2 +-
 flink-table/flink-table-test-utils/pom.xml         |   2 +-
 flink-table/pom.xml                                |   2 +-
 .../flink-clients-test-utils/pom.xml               |   2 +-
 .../flink-connector-test-utils/pom.xml             |   2 +-
 .../flink-migration-test-utils/pom.xml             |   2 +-
 .../flink-table-filesystem-test-utils/pom.xml      |   2 +-
 .../flink-test-utils-connector/pom.xml             |   2 +-
 .../flink-test-utils-junit/pom.xml                 |   2 +-
 flink-test-utils-parent/flink-test-utils/pom.xml   |   2 +-
 flink-test-utils-parent/pom.xml                    |   2 +-
 flink-tests-java17/pom.xml                         |   2 +-
 flink-tests/pom.xml                                |   2 +-
 .../flink-walkthrough-common/pom.xml               |   2 +-
 .../flink-walkthrough-datastream-java/pom.xml      |   2 +-
 .../flink-walkthrough-table-java/pom.xml           |   2 +-
 flink-walkthroughs/pom.xml                         |   2 +-
 flink-yarn-tests/pom.xml                           |   2 +-
 flink-yarn/pom.xml                                 |   2 +-
 pom.xml                                            |   2 +-
 tools/ci/flink-ci-tools/pom.xml                    |   4 +-
 197 files changed, 1475 insertions(+), 550 deletions(-)
 copy 
flink-runtime/src/main/java/org/apache/flink/runtime/rest/handler/job/rescales/{JobRescalesHistoryHandler.java
 => JobRescalesOverviewHandler.java} (80%)
 create mode 100644 
flink-runtime/src/main/java/org/apache/flink/runtime/rest/messages/job/rescales/JobRescalesOverview.java
 copy 
flink-runtime/src/main/java/org/apache/flink/runtime/rest/messages/job/rescales/{JobRescalesHistoryHeaders.java
 => JobRescalesOverviewHeaders.java} (74%)
 copy 
flink-runtime/src/test/java/org/apache/flink/runtime/rest/handler/job/rescales/{JobRescalesHistoryHandlerTest.java
 => JobRescalesOverviewHandlerTest.java} (58%)

Reply via email to